1. ANW ARUL HAQ, J.-After hearing the petitioner in person and the learned Assistant Advocate-General, Punjab, we have decided to convert this petition into an appeal, and to dispose it of accordingly .
2. On the 10th of September 1975, a first information report was registered at Police Station City Sheikhupura regarding the murder of one Gharib Alam. Besides, naming certain persons as the actual assailants the complainant also named two persons, namely, Raja Shafiqur Rehman and Raja Khush Bakhtur Rehman as being concerned in the conspiracy to commit this murder . However , as a result of investigation, the Police wanted to arrest the present appellant Mansoor Ahmad Bhatti. He accordingly applied for bail before arrest, but his application was rejected by a learned Judge of the Lahore High Court by his order dated the 27th of November 1975.
3. It is submitted on behalf of the petitioner that he was named neither as an actual assailant nor as a conspirator in the first information report which was in sufficient detail, and accordingly his apprehended arrest was due to ulterior motives.
4. In the circumstances, we consider that the appellant is entitled to be released on bail. We would accordingly accept this appeal and confirm the interim order of bail already made by this Court on 5- 12-75.
